#d719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d719ff is composed of 84.3% red, 9.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 289.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.9%. #d719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#af00ff.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

#d719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d719ff has RGB values of R:215, G:25,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 14096895.

Shades and Tints of #d719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040005 is the darkest color, while #fdf1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d719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928395 is the less saturated color, while #d719ff is the most saturated one.
